Welcome to Jacmel!

Founded in 1698, Jacmel is one of the most ancient cities in the country. It is located at 85 kms South of Port-au-Prince.


POPULATION: In 2005, the town of Jacmel had 146,000 inhabitants. The town covers an area of 443,88 km2 with a population density of 329 inhabitants/km2.

An estimated 36% of the population is under the age of 15 years old, 57% from 15-64, and 7% 65 and above.


SCHOOLS: The town of Jacmel has two hundred thirty-four (234) schools. These institutions are categorized as follows: thirty (30) preschools, one hundred sixty (160) primary schools, and forty-four (44) secondary schools.

Interestingly, these schools are more prevalent in rural aera than urban. An estimated one hundred ninety-two (192)schools are in rural area versus forty-two in urban.

More than 2/3 of all schools are private. There are also six (6) centers of alphabetisation, thirty (30) trade and technical schools, one (1) school of higher learning, and three (3) universities.


BUSINESS: Commerce, agriculture, and arts and crafts are the main economic activities. An estimated seven hundred seventy-one (771) commercial establishments are located in Jacmel. These businesses are as follows: three hundred twenty-nine(329) small mom and po stores, one hundred twelve (112)larger stores, four (4) commercial banks, ten (10) credit unions, nine (9) currency excnage centers, twelve (12) maisons d’affaires, and one hundred fifty-six (156) lottery outlets.
